About the role:
The LESNW Executive Assistant operates with a high level of autonomy and professional judgement in the planning, prioritisation, and execution of administrative and governance related responsibilities.
Acting on behalf of the Executive Director, the role is authorised to manage scheduling and workflow priorities, routine and confidential correspondence, coordinate engagement with stakeholders and make informed decisions within established organisational policies, procedures, and delegated authority limits.
The position may represent the Executive Director in communications and preliminary decision-making discussions when appropriate, ensuring matters are progressed efficiently and professionally.
The Executive Assistant is expected to exercise sound judgement, maintain confidentiality, and uphold professional standards in all interactions, with escalation of matters of strategic, legal, or reputational significance as appropriate.
This is a full time and ongoing position.
